The kids chipped in and signed me up for Scrapfest today for my 38th birthday present. For those of you unfamiliar with Scrapfest and all its glory, it's a 12 hour day (10:30 am - 10:30 pm) of open forum scrapbooking down at Scrapbooks, Etc. (my favorite store). We each have a table to work at and access to all of the machines and die cutters and fun new tools and such. Plus you can shop anytime you want during the class and add it to your tab, paying at the end with a 10% discount on the total. There's typically about 30 of us crazy women in a class, and I have grown to love my scrapbooking friends. There is a group of six of us that have all met over the past couple of years through this fun hobby of ours and we so look forward to getting together every so often to reconnect and spend a fun filled day together.
